<?xml version="1.0" encoding="UTF-8"?><rss x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:content="http://purl.org/rss/1.0/modules/content/" xmlns:atom="http://www.w3.org/2005/Atom" version="2.0"><channel><title><![CDATA[Problem mit der CListCtrl]]></title><description><![CDATA[<p>Habe ein Programm geschriben (SDI, CListView), das nach einem Datenbankzugriff, die Daten in ein CListCtrl schreiben soll. Die Daten wurden vorher in der Doc-Klasse in CStringarrays geschrieben. In der OnItitUpdate()-Funktion der View-Klasse habe ich die Spalten und die Styles der CListCtrl vordefiniert. Jetzt möchte ich die Daten aus der Doc-Klasse in die CListCtrl übernehmen. Wie geht das am besten???</p>
<p>Danke.</p>
]]></description><link>https://www.c-plusplus.net/forum/topic/69976/problem-mit-der-clistctrl</link><generator>RSS for Node</generator><lastBuildDate>Fri, 01 May 2026 10:52:12 GMT</lastBuildDate><atom:link href="https://www.c-plusplus.net/forum/topic/69976.rss" rel="self" type="application/rss+xml"/><pubDate>Fri, 02 Apr 2004 12:50:35 GMT</pubDate><ttl>60</ttl><item><title><![CDATA[Reply to Problem mit der CListCtrl on Fri, 02 Apr 2004 12:50:35 GMT]]></title><description><![CDATA[<p>Habe ein Programm geschriben (SDI, CListView), das nach einem Datenbankzugriff, die Daten in ein CListCtrl schreiben soll. Die Daten wurden vorher in der Doc-Klasse in CStringarrays geschrieben. In der OnItitUpdate()-Funktion der View-Klasse habe ich die Spalten und die Styles der CListCtrl vordefiniert. Jetzt möchte ich die Daten aus der Doc-Klasse in die CListCtrl übernehmen. Wie geht das am besten???</p>
<p>Danke.</p>
]]></description><link>https://www.c-plusplus.net/forum/post/493811</link><guid isPermaLink="true">https://www.c-plusplus.net/forum/post/493811</guid><dc:creator><![CDATA[ElRusso]]></dc:creator><pubDate>Fri, 02 Apr 2004 12:50:35 GMT</pubDate></item><item><title><![CDATA[Reply to Problem mit der CListCtrl on Fri, 02 Apr 2004 13:05:49 GMT]]></title><description><![CDATA[<p>das ListCtrl in der OnInitialUpdate füllen,<br />
oder direkt von ListCtrl ableiten, und dort mittels<br />
eines Zeigers auf dokument füllen, und evtl direkt updaten.</p>
<p>Devil</p>
]]></description><link>https://www.c-plusplus.net/forum/post/493821</link><guid isPermaLink="true">https://www.c-plusplus.net/forum/post/493821</guid><dc:creator><![CDATA[phlox81]]></dc:creator><pubDate>Fri, 02 Apr 2004 13:05:49 GMT</pubDate></item><item><title><![CDATA[Reply to Problem mit der CListCtrl on Fri, 02 Apr 2004 13:17:27 GMT]]></title><description><![CDATA[<p>Danke für die schnelle Antwort.</p>
<p>Meinst du viellecht das:</p>
<pre><code>CListView::OnInitialUpdate();
	CCdkeyDoc* pDoc = GetDocument();
	CListCtrl&amp; lCtrl = GetListCtrl();
	lCtrl.SetExtendedStyle(LVS_EX_GRIDLINES | LVS_EX_FULLROWSELECT );
	lCtrl.InsertColumn(0, &quot;No.&quot;, LVCFMT_LEFT, 30);
	lCtrl.InsertColumn(1, &quot;Name&quot;, LVCFMT_LEFT, 300);
	ModifyStyle(NULL, LVS_REPORT, 0);

	int i = lCtrl.InsertItem(pDoc-&gt;m_anzahl, &quot;...&quot;);
	lCtrl.SetItemText(i, 1, pDoc-&gt;m_element);
</code></pre>
<p>Leider funktioniert das nicht. Ich glaube das liegt dadran, dass die Funktion OnInitialUpdate() vor dem Datenbankzugriff aufgerufen wird.</p>
]]></description><link>https://www.c-plusplus.net/forum/post/493832</link><guid isPermaLink="true">https://www.c-plusplus.net/forum/post/493832</guid><dc:creator><![CDATA[ElRusso]]></dc:creator><pubDate>Fri, 02 Apr 2004 13:17:27 GMT</pubDate></item></channel></rss>